Physical DescriptionAn intact admission ticket for the March 4, 1933 inauguration of Franklin Roosevelt and John Garner.
On the front of the light orange and white ticket is an image of an inaugural seal overprinted with black text that reads: INAUGURATION / OF THE / PRESIDENT / AND / VICE PRESIDENT / OF THE / UNITED STATES / WASHINGTON, D. C. MARCH 4, 1933 / ADMIT ONE. The ticket is for the President's Stand, Stand 1, Gate Left, Section E, Row 5, Seat 3. The manufacturer's information is printed vertically along the perforation line: GLOBE TICKET COMPANY, PHILADELPHIA.
On the opposite side of the ticket, on a dark orange, blue, and white illustration of a rising sun with the date "1933," are oval black and white halftone photographic portraits of FDR (left) and Garner (right). On the right side of the ticket (the removable portion) is printed text that reads: This TICKET WILL / NOT BE HONORED / IF SOLD OR OFFERED / FOR RESALE AT / MORE THAN THE / PRICE HEREON, OR / IF OTHERSIDE / USED CONTRARY TO / THE CONDITIONS / UNDER WHICH IT / WAS ACCEPTED / BY THE ORIGINAL / PURCHASER.
